WPP anticipates Asian comeback

Article Abstract:

WPP Group PLC CEO Martin Sorrel believes that Asia-Pacific's marketing communication industry is slowly recovering from the financial crisis that hit the region in 1997. Anticipating the Asia-Pacific comeback and aware of its development potential, Sorrel plans to move at least one-third of the advertising agency's operations in the region. Sorrell is confident that WPP Groups's profits will significantly improve if it strengthens and deepens its offers in the area.

4As to set spec creative guidelines

Article Abstract:

The American Association of Advertising Agencies, a New York-based ad industry association in the US, is creating a set of guidelines that would define speculative creative work. A survey to be conducted in 1999 would determine what guidelines to be developed. The decision to create a set of guidelines followed an initial survey of 28 search consultants and 53 advertisers about the agency review process.
